General annotation (Comments)

Function

Mitogen-activated protein kinase involved in a signal transduction pathway that is activated by changes in the osmolarity of the extracellular environment. Controls osmotic regulation of transcription of target genes By similarity.

Catalytic activity

ATP + a protein = ADP + a phosphoprotein.

Cofactor

Magnesium By similarity.

Enzyme regulation

Activated by tyrosine and threonine phosphorylation By similarity.

Subcellular location

Cytoplasm By similarity. Nucleus By similarity.

Domain

The TXY motif contains the threonine and tyrosine residues whose phosphorylation activates the MAP kinases.

Post-translational modification

Dually phosphorylated on Thr-171 and Tyr-173, which activates the enzyme By similarity.

Sequence similarities

Belongs to the protein kinase superfamily. Ser/Thr protein kinase family. MAP kinase subfamily. HOG1 sub-subfamily.

Contains 1 protein kinase domain.
